Abstract

The present invention relates to a method for real-time processing of an information message in a centralized type broadband network terminal (B-NT), in which information requiring real-time processing is separated from information not requiring real-time processing, The upper controller 11 performs the reporting only and the lower controller 12 directly transfers the information to the higher controller 11 when the real controller 12 does not require real time processing, 11, it is possible to perform real-time processing by transmitting control information through the lower control unit 12, and each channel is provided for each function device 17 so that an event can be buffered when an event occurs Since there are 64 channels in the message transfer between the upper level control device 11 and the lower level control device 12, the number of messages can be buffered by this number.
